Output 391f23daaa5c60ca031a59d44998dd3479bd7805c353dbeec43fc3d18f97f897:1

value
79351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0e24a90c430e1f95437b0bc7ead61806af8960 OP_EQUAL
address
3HZLScJ1TVmFBdUxYd6G4rEWfQ8xDVfK4J
transaction
391f23daaa5c60ca031a59d44998dd3479bd7805c353dbeec43fc3d18f97f897
confirmations
171315
spent
true